Former Soccer Player Ohad Bozaglo Hospitalized for Psychiatric Evaluation
Former Israeli soccer player Ohad Bozaglo revealed on Thursday that he voluntarily admitted himself to Abarbanel Medical Center for psychiatric evaluation. Bozaglo, who was later released, explained his hospitalization on Instagram, stating, "For all those asking where I disappeared to, I was admitted consensually... the truth is with me." He later added, "Get ready for big chaos, don't be afraid! Believe. And then life is a dream including resurrection and eternal life."
According to an Mako report, Bozaglo sought evaluation for schizophrenia at the request of two friends. Medical staff at the institution determined he did not have the condition and he was promptly discharged. Bozaglo told Mako, "World redemption is on the way, and I just wanted to give people a taste of science about a world that is all wonders. Get ready for big chaos, don't be afraid! Believe. And then life is a dream including resurrection and eternal life."
